History

The sub sandwich, also known as a hoagie or grinder, originated in the United States in the early 20th century. It is believed to have been created by Italian immigrants in Philadelphia, who filled long rolls of bread with meats, cheeses, and vegetables. The sub sandwich quickly became popular across the country, and is now a staple in many American households.

How to prepare

  1. Spread the cut sides of the bread with dressing.
  2. Place layers of meat and cheese on the bottom half of the loaf.
  3. Cover with the top half of the bread.
  4. Cut the sandwich into 4 to 6 pieces.
